CMU-Pitt BRIDGE Center Standardizes on BIDS with Flywheel’s Research Platform

CMU’s BRIDGE Center (the CMU-Pitt BRIDGE Center) faced rapidly growing MRI data volumes and no easy, standardized way for researchers to access, process, and share imaging data. To adopt the Brain Imaging Data Structure (BIDS) standard without building an in-house system, CMU selected Flywheel’s research data and computational management platform (cloud instance with containerized Gears) to support BIDS standardization and scalable data administration.

Flywheel automated secure, encrypted transfer of scanner data into a BRIDGE-controlled cloud instance, applied the Center’s naming conventions to auto-curate files to BIDS, and automatically scheduled quality-control and preprocessing pipelines (e.g., MRIQC, fMRIPrep) via Gears. As a result, Flywheel helped CMU standardize workflows, reduce manual curation and early-stage processing errors, ensure consistent data quality across protocols, and simplify sharing and collaborative analysis, enabling the BRIDGE Center to become one of the first BIDS-compliant MRI research centers.
